Tartaglia’s new appointment formalizes a deep collaborative history with the studio. Having served as a writer, director, and puppeteer on high-profile projects like the Emmy-winning Fraggle Rock: Back to the Rock, he has become a foundational creative force for the company. Lisa Henson described him as a "quadruple threat" whose expertise across production and performance consistently elevates the studio's output. His recent portfolio includes co-creating the Amazon Kids+ series Jim Henson's Monster Dance and directing the PBS KIDS special Wowsabout.
Beyond his television work, Tartaglia remains a significant presence in live entertainment. He is currently shepherding the New York City premiere of Fraggle Rock: Back to the Rock LIVE at The New Victory Theater, with a national tour scheduled for the fall. His extensive background—which spans Broadway credits such as Avenue Q and Shrek the Musical—positions him to drive the company’s expansion in both live performance and screen development as he balances his executive duties with his ongoing work in puppetry and direction.
